Abstract

An airbag inflator assembly is disclosed that includes a container containing a charge of pressurized gas and having a peripheral surface surrounding an opening in the container. A burst disc member has one side capacitive discharge welded to the peripheral surface of the container to seal the opening and thus confine the pressurized gas within the container. An ignitor assembly includes an ignitor assembly housing and ignition elements constructed and arranged to generate sufficient force to break the seal formed by the burst disc member and release the pressurized gas from the container. The ignitor elements are disposed substantially within the ignitor assembly housing. The ignitor assembly housing is an integrally formed unitary construction capacitive discharge welded to a side of the burst disc member opposite to the one side. In a preferred embodiment, the welds are formed by (1) applying a force to urge i) the first side of the burst disc member into engagement with the peripheral surface of the container and ii) the peripheral surface of the ignitor assembly housing into engagement with the second side of the burst disc member. Also, pulses of electrical discharge are applied i) in a vicinity of the forceable engagement between the first side of the burst disc member and the peripheral surface of the container until welded to one another, and ii) in a vicinity of the forceable engagement between the peripheral surface of the ignitor assembly housing and the second side of the burst disc member until welded to one another.
